Output 97b374d11896ab3f3bb47feaaf1fcb1053b4734023ec92de56f9125ec2191013:532

value
671242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091e031e774fe8800e27448ab7f611be75f4bd26 OP_EQUAL
address
32XDxZ3Zn59KkxiPyyt1DVBxjEstUh7etj
transaction
97b374d11896ab3f3bb47feaaf1fcb1053b4734023ec92de56f9125ec2191013
confirmations
556007
spent
true